    The Rise of the AI Buyer: What Exactly is Agentic Commerce?

    To understand the impact of this shift, one must recognize that Agentic Commerce is fundamentally and architecturally different from traditional e-commerce methodologies, as well as distinct from the previous generation of rudimentary customer service chatbots. Whereas a conventional, rule-based chatbot embedded on a retail website operates reactively—waiting for user input and, at its most helpful, providing a hyperlink directing the user to a product page—an AI agent operates proactively, contextually, and highly independently on behalf of the user.

    Consider the evolution of the search query. A modern consumer no longer simply types in a fragmented keyword string such as: 'black running shoes size 43 neutral'. Instead, the digitally fluent consumer issues a highly complex, context-rich command, commonly referred to in the industry as a prompt, which provides a comprehensive persona and specific constraints: 'I am going to run the Rotterdam marathon in exactly three months. My current training schedule requires me to run primarily on asphalt surfaces. I have a neutral biomechanical running gait and my absolute maximum budget is 180 euros. Find the absolute best-reviewed running shoes that are currently in stock in a European size 43 at a highly reputable Dutch webshop. Automatically apply any active internet discount codes you can find, and proceed to complete the checkout using my saved payment credentials.'

    In this highly sophisticated scenario, the end-user never actually visits the retailer's visually designed homepage. Not a single category page is organically browsed, no carefully curated lifestyle product photography is scrolled through, and the traditional, often friction-heavy checkout flow—which normally requires the tedious manual entry of shipping addresses, billing details, and payment preferences—is mercilessly bypassed altogether. The AI agent performs all the heavy lifting and preliminary research. It compares complex product specifications by reading structured data, verifies real-time stock availability by communicating directly with merchant APIs, and seamlessly finalizes the entire purchase.

    This aggressive evolution of digital commerce partially transfers the ultimate purchasing authority from the human consumer to the underlying algorithm. Consequently, brands must realize that they no longer need to exclusively persuade the human consumer through beautiful visual storytelling, emotional branding, and frictionless UX design. Instead, they must prioritize feeding the underlying data models and training sets of these AI systems with highly structured, completely error-free, and instantly processable product information.

    The Technical Engine: Understanding the Agentic Commerce Protocol (ACP)

    The monumental leap from an artificial intelligence that provides conversational advice to an AI that is granted the authority to actually spend real-world capital requires a highly robust, universally adaptable, and incredibly secure technical infrastructure. This is precisely the operational gap that prominent global tech conglomerates are currently rushing to bridge. A vital, foundational initiative in this realm is the ongoing development of the theoretical Agentic Commerce Protocol (ACP), which aims to serve as an open, standardized architectural framework initiated by major industry players like OpenAI, functioning in close, strategic collaboration with global payment processing giants such as Stripe.

    The fundamental, overarching objective of the Agentic Commerce Protocol is to comprehensively standardize the digital communication pathways between Large Language Models and traditional e-commerce back-end servers. Without a universally accepted technological standard, an AI agent would theoretically be forced to construct a bespoke, brittle web-scraper for every single individual webshop it intends to interact with. Such an erratic methodology invariably leads to critical data parsing errors, catastrophically abandoned payment sessions, and severe cybersecurity vulnerabilities.

    How Does the Protocol Function in Operational Practice?

    Within the sophisticated architecture of the ACP and other conceptually similar digital protocols, the underlying concept of checkout_sessions plays a starring role. When a consumer's personalized AI agent receives the explicit command to execute a transaction, the digital agent immediately initiates a highly secure request to the retailer's server via an Application Programming Interface (API). The merchant—often facilitated by payment infrastructure providers like Stripe—instantly returns a unique, cryptographically secure token. This token ensures that the entire system knows exactly which specific Product ID is being discussed, locking in the dynamically updated current price, the precise geographical shipping costs, and confirming the exact warehouse inventory availability.

    An even more radical and transformative structural component of this architecture is the emerging principle of delegated payments.

    "The true breakthrough of Agentic Commerce is not found within the evolution of search behavior, but rather in the digital handover of the consumer's wallet. When a user explicitly grants an artificial intelligence a financial mandate and a strict operational budget to execute transactions completely autonomously, virtually every single form of traditional friction within the digital purchasing journey simply evaporates."

    In the framework of delegated payments, the human user pre-authorizes the AI agent through a secure cryptographic environment. For instance, the AI is granted access to a virtual, single-use or mathematically constrained credit card with a hard, unbreakable spending limit of 200 euros, alongside explicit, programmable permissions to execute purchases exclusively within specifically defined product categories. The moment the digital agent identifies the theoretically perfect marathon running shoe that matches all prompt criteria, it entirely bypasses the consumer-facing graphic payment gateway on the retailer's website. Instead, the final financial transaction is seamlessly concluded via an invisible, backend-to-backend API call.

    Major global e-commerce platforms are currently integrating these sophisticated technologies into their core codebases at a breakneck pace. Powerhouses like Shopify and Etsy are among the very first digital ecosystems to actively open their deeply guarded infrastructures to third-party AI agents. For the millions of independent merchants operating upon these platforms, this technological leap signifies that their digital inventory becomes almost instantaneously available for direct purchase via conversational interfaces like ChatGPT, Microsoft Copilot, or Google Gemini—provided, of course, that their underlying structural product data is immaculately formatted.

    Beyond the Search Bar: The Permanent Shift in Consumer Behavior

    The rapid, mainstream adoption of AI agents is having a profoundly disruptive, and in some cases disastrous, effect on the classic marketing funnel that consumer brands have relied upon for decades. The venerated AIDA model—Attention, Interest, Desire, Action—is experiencing severe temporal compression. The entire orientation and research phase (the Interest and Desire components) now takes place exclusively within the textual interface of the artificial intelligence. The modern consumer essentially quantum-leaps directly from the initial realization of a biological or material need straight to the final purchasing action.

    Within the highly technical realm of data analysis and performance marketing, this phenomenon is increasingly described as the absolute dominance of the "last click factor." According to comprehensive, peer-reviewed research published by Comscore, the entire concept of multi-touch digital attribution changes completely when consumers utilize AI for their shopping journeys. In previous eras, a traditional Google search provided the user with ten diverse options (representing the orientation phase), after which the customer independently clicked a link, evaluated a website, and purchased. In the era of AI assistants, the AI unequivocally claims the 'last click' for itself. The algorithm is the ultimate entity that makes the conclusive, binding decision based purely upon the multi-variable parameters the human user has initially established.

    The digital conversion rates observed within this novel model are significantly, undeniably higher than traditional web traffic. Aggregated data originating from forward-thinking Shopify merchants who are currently experimenting with direct AI endpoint integrations reveals a striking reality: when a specific product is recommended by an AI and can be checked out directly within the chat interface, the cognitive and physical friction drops to absolute zero, pushing purchasing intent to its theoretical maximum. A drastically shorter, entirely frictionless funnel inevitably and logically leads to substantially fewer abandoned shopping carts.

    Simultaneously, the harsh reality of data science demonstrates exactly how incredibly fluid and volatile these AI-driven product recommendations actually are. Rigorous technical testing reveals that a staggering 80 percent of product recommendations generated by models like ChatGPT change drastically the very moment the model's 'live web search' functionality is toggled on. Without active access to the current, real-time web, the LLM is forced to base its answers almost entirely upon historical training data, which inherently and heavily favors massive, historically established legacy brands. However, with real-time web access enabled, the model instantaneously scours the current internet landscape to find the absolute best, currently available, actively stocked options for the user. This dynamic forcefully underscores the critical importance of real-time technical findability. If your highly sought-after product is temporarily marked as 'out-of-stock' in your website's source code today, the AI agent will instantly abandon your brand and pivot to recommend a direct competitor's alternative without a second thought.

    The Technological Blueprint from the East: Why China Currently Leads

    To truly comprehend the maturity, potential, and inevitable operational future of Agentic Commerce, Western marketing professionals must cast their gaze toward the highly advanced Asian digital markets. While Western technology titans are largely currently pre-occupied with establishing theoretical open standards, navigating complex data privacy frameworks, and fighting anti-monopoly legislation, the dominant Chinese super-apps have long since built, deployed, and scaled the infrastructure required to facilitate autonomous, agent-driven purchases. The utterly seamless, legally unencumbered integration of dominant social media platforms, massive e-commerce logistical networks, and frictionless digital payment infrastructures provides the absolute perfect breeding ground for this technological revolution.

    Alibaba has undeniably set the global benchmark by deeply integrating its proprietary Large Language Model, known as Qwen, directly into the core of its gigantic e-commerce platform, Taobao. To understand the scale: Taobao currently hosts an estimated inventory of 4 billion individual products and actively serves roughly 300 million weekly active users with deeply integrated, AI-driven functionalities. Within the walls of this massive closed ecosystem, AI agents do not function as a quirky, external novelty tool; they act as the absolute beating heart of the entire retail experience. Through the Alipay digital wallet ecosystem, agentic payments are currently being processed on a scale that defies Western comprehension. Furthermore, the AI dynamically manages user budgets, intelligently stacks multiple promotional discounts to find the mathematical minimum price, and executes final payments without requiring explicit human manual intervention for every single purchase.

    The sheer volume at which these transactions occur is globally unprecedented. During the widely publicized annual 618-shopping festival, Alibaba successfully reported that a staggering 120 million individual e-commerce transactions were either entirely or partially guided, filtered, or directly checked out by autonomous AI agents on a weekly basis. Fiercely competing Asian platforms, such as JD.com and Meituan, are aggressively pursuing the exact same operational strategy, creating an environment where physical supply chain logistics, instant purchasing capability, and highly personalized AI advice conceptually merge into one unified digital entity.

    ByteDance, the massive corporate entity behind the global phenomenon TikTok, beautifully illustrates the immediate future of retail with the deployment of their incredibly advanced AI assistant, Doubao. The platform is currently dedicating massive resources to perfecting the concept of "one-sentence shopping." In this radically simplified UX flow, the user simply speaks a single, complex need into their smartphone microphone, after which Doubao autonomously scours the internet, mathematically aggregates sentiment from thousands of video reviews, detects the absolute best financial deal, and independently places the order directly into the vendor's logistical fulfillment system. For the modern Chinese digital consumer, Agentic Commerce is not a distant, speculative futuristic concept; it is the standard, everyday operational procedure for purchasing goods online.

    GEO and AEO for 2026: Achieving True Visibility in a World Without Traditional Links

    If the vast majority of consumers are no longer organically navigating to your visually designed website, how do you mathematically ensure that sophisticated AI models actually detect, validate, and subsequently recommend your specific product catalog? Answering this existential business question requires a massive philosophical and technical shift away from traditional, keyword-stuffed Search Engine Optimization (SEO) and towards the emerging disciplines of Generative Engine Optimization (GEO) and Answer Engine Optimization (AEO).

    Historically, conventional SEO revolved almost entirely around algorithmically scoring on highly specific, high-volume keywords and obsessively building massive networks of inbound backlinks to signal domain authority. AEO, conversely, is completely distinct; it revolves exclusively around provable factual accuracy, deep linguistic context, and absolute, pristine machine-readability. An LLM essentially attempts to locate mathematical consensus across the vastness of the internet. If twenty highly reputable, globally recognized running blogs all distinctly identify your specific brand's product as the absolute best biomechanical shoe for asphalt surfaces, the artificial intelligence will adopt this consensus as an absolute, undeniable fact. In the data science community, this process is known as entity building: the rigorous strategic process of mathematically ensuring that your corporate brand, your specific products, and their unique physical properties are irrefutably and clearly defined within massive public knowledge databases, and are continually mentioned (often referred to as unstructured brand mentions) across highly authoritative digital platforms.

    A relatively new, yet incredibly critical technical development in the operational unlocking of product information for AI systems is the deliberate implementation of an llms.txt file. In the same way that traditional webmasters have relied upon a robots.txt file for over two decades to politely instruct the Googlebot on how to crawl a site, the llms.txt (which is typically a highly simplified, incredibly lightweight Markdown file formally hosted on the root directory of your digital domain) functions as a completely stripped-down, purely factual, textual representation of your most vital corporate and product information. It is crucial to understand that LLMs vastly prefer parsing clean Markdown text over attempting to render incredibly complex server-side DOM structures or wading through heavy, bloated JavaScript-rendered websites. By proactively offering your most crucial product datasets, legal warranty conditions, and unique selling propositions in this delightfully simple format, you substantially, mathematically increase the statistical likelihood of your catalog being correctly indexed by the newest generation of AI crawlers.

    Furthermore, it is pivotal to internalize that an AI fundamentally reasons based purely on structured data arrays and verifiable evidentiary proof. Website content that is heavily saturated with vague, emotive, unquantifiable marketing terminology (e.g., "the most revolutionary shoe ever created") is routinely and mathematically bypassed by advanced algorithms. These algorithms are specifically trained to actively hunt for 'cited-worthy content': highly structured texts that feature deeply concrete statistics, verifiable quotes from recognized industry experts, and hard, scientifically defensible facts.

    Concrete, Actionable Do's and Don'ts for Mastering AEO

    To survive the transition, technical marketing teams must adhere to a new set of strict operational guidelines:

    Do's:

    • Aggressively Optimize Structured Data (Schema.org): You must guarantee that every single product page is fortified with flawless, mathematically comprehensive Schema.org markup code. Vital datapoints such as the active price, real-time inventory status (InStock), aggregated review data, globally recognized GTIN codes (barcodes), and physical specifications must be instantly readable by automated bots without requiring visual page rendering.
    • Relentlessly Focus on Entity Building: Ensure beyond a shadow of a doubt that your brand identity is accurately mentioned on Wikipedia, carefully structured within Wikidata, featured in digital press releases on wire services, and deeply historically embedded in independent, third-party review sites. Remember: AI models triangulate multiple disparate information nodes to calculate what is fundamentally "true."
    • Provide Hard Statistics and Expert Quotes: Deliberately weave hard, verifiable mathematical figures, exact material composition specifications, and authoritative quotes from your lead product developers directly into your core product descriptions.
    • Upload an llms.txt or strictly defined .md structural file: Proactively make all vital product documentation and technical manuals available in a pure Markdown format, ensuring that resource-constrained LLMs can easily ingest and perfectly process the data without requiring complex, failure-prone visual web rendering.

    Don'ts:

    • Never Rely Exclusively on JavaScript-rendered content: If essential product information, crucial sizing charts, and active pricing variables only load into the browser after the human user has physically scrolled down the page or clicked a specific interactive button, the automated AI agent simply does not "see" this data, effectively rendering your product invisible to the machine.
    • Do Not Publish Generic, AI-Generated Texts: Advanced AI models natively recognize the mathematical signatures of content generated by other AI models. Publishing "thirteen-in-a-dozen," highly generic, GPT-written product descriptions explicitly adds zero unique informational value to the global training model, and consequently, these pages will be forcefully ranked lower in the algorithm's confidence matrix.
    • Do Not Focus Purely on Your Main Proprietary Channel: Stop exclusively investing all technical resources into your own private .com or .nl domain. Ensure that you aggressively sell (provided it aligns with your corporate margin strategy) via massive external platforms like Shopify or Amazon, as these behemoth entities are fully guaranteed to be the very first to successfully integrate directly with cutting-edge Agentic Commerce protocols.

    The Strategic 90-Day Roadmap for Modern Marketing Directors

    Deeply comprehending the underlying theory of this AI paradigm shift is merely step one; actively orchestrating this massive, uncomfortable change within the complex siloes of your corporate organization is the truly difficult step two. To ensure that your retail brand is fundamentally technically and strategically prepared for the complete, inevitable global rollout of Agentic Commerce and fully autonomous AI-search, we highly advise immediately implementing the following deeply practical, incredibly urgent 90-day execution roadmap.

    Month 1: Triage Auditing and Technical Foundation Repair (Days 1 - 30)

    • Initiate a comprehensive, ruthlessly holistic technical audit focused entirely on the health of your site's structured data. Utilize advanced JSON-LD validation tools to mathematically guarantee that your dynamic pricing, real-time warehouse inventory (which is the absolute make-or-break metric for successful digital transactions), and exact product identification numbers (GTIN/EAN) are 100% accurate and immediately machine-readable on every single category and product page.
    • Deeply analyze the core accessibility of your domain architecture for modern AI crawlers. Technically verify whether vital, conversion-driving text or specifications are lazily hidden behind interactive, client-side Javascript windows or heavy DOM loads, and assign your development team to immediately rectify this structural flaw.
    • Draft, compile, and subsequently publish a robust first version of an llms.txt file detailing your corporate brand identity, historical legacy, warranty policies, and your top-tier product categories, explicitly placing this file directly into the absolute root of your web domain.

    Month 2: Radical Content Adaptation and Entity Building (Days 31 - 60)

    • Conduct a strategic internal inventory to identify your top 20 most profitable or most strategic products. Completely rewrite these specific product descriptions, aggressively shifting away from fluffy, generic, adjective-heavy marketing language toward deeply data-driven, highly factual, explicitly technical, and easily validated (cited-worthy) content frameworks.
    • Launch a highly targeted, aggressive PR and digital link-building strategy with an explicit, singular focus on capturing authoritative brand mentions in highly specific niche-blogs, major recognized news media outlets, and massive public knowledge bases like Wikidata. Crucially, do this not merely to capture the traditional SEO referring link, but specifically to mathematically strengthen the core 'entity' identity of your commercial brand deeply within the foundational LLM training datasets.

    Month 3: Controlled Experimentation and API Integration (Days 61 - 90)

    • Dedicate technical resources to actively investigate emerging API solutions aimed at external digital platforms. If your e-commerce backend utilizes massive systems such as Shopify or Magento, meticulously map out exactly which specific technical plug-ins (for instance, those currently being built in closed-beta collaboration with Stripe or OpenAI) are scheduled to become publicly available to facilitate delegated payments in the coming quarters.
    • Deliberately ring-fence and allocate an experimental testing budget specifically for these newly emerging, AI-driven conversion channels. Ensure that you establish a highly agile, cross-functional internal task force capable of deeply analyzing the incredibly rapid weekly shifts in AI-driven search volume (metrics that are increasingly measurable natively within Bing/Copilot webmaster tools and Perplexity's analytics dashboards) and capable of translating those raw data points into an actionable corporate strategy.
